Thetis and Nuclear Madness by David Steen

TICA’s board meeting agenda on October 7, 2025 was too full to hear me request its support for the United Nations campaign to ban all nuclear weapons. 

Here it is: Imagine being locked in a house with a person who might kill you if you show weakness or drop your guard. Each of you has a can of gas. To ignite one in an attack or defense will incinerate you both. Our house is our world. Our gas is nuclear weapons. The risk it will destroy us increases by the day. To believe nuclear annihilation can’t happen -- that no nation is crazy enough to light the match -- or even that nuclear war can be contained and prove victorious for one side are dangerous delusions. Objective observers of history and psychology know that acts of madness and mistakes are inevitable. With nuclear weapons, the horrific consequences defy imagination.
